Gear Review: Teva Apres Clog
Contributed by: Kimberly Higgins on 8/28/2007

If you are looking for a clog that molds to your foot only after a few times of wearing it - after a long hike, trail run, mountain bike ride or paddle this is the clog to wear. If your feet had faces, they would be smiling.

Similar in looks to the Crock it is more stylish, supportive, cushioned and comfortable. Made with Teva's legendary Mush® footbed it is to take on and off, yet stays on your feet and has plenty of traction. The rubber outsole is durable and the vented design lets your feet breathe and dry quickly. They come in a variety of colors ranging from vivid blue, black/olive, and red to name a few. Nobody knows outdoor sandals like Teva. $50. teva.com
